The logistics corridor between Guanajuato, Mexico and Atlanta, Georgia represents a vital trade route connecting Mexico's central industrial heartland with one of the United States' most important logistics hubs. This cross-border corridor spans approximately 2,180 kilometers and facilitates the movement of goods between Mexico's thriving manufacturing sector and Atlanta's extensive distribution network.
The corridor's strategic importance stems from Guanajuato's position as a manufacturing powerhouse, particularly in automotive, aerospace, and electronics industries, and Atlanta's role as a major transportation and logistics center in the southeastern United States. The route primarily utilizes Mexico's Federal Highway 45 and the United States' Interstate 85, connecting through key border crossings such as Laredo or Eagle Pass. Control Terrestre's expertise in cross-border operations ensures seamless transit through customs procedures and compliance with both Mexican and US regulations.
This corridor serves diverse industries including automotive parts, consumer electronics, industrial equipment, and agricultural products. Origin
Guanajuato
Guanajuato, located in central Mexico, serves as a strategic logistics hub due to its central geographic position and robust industrial infrastructure. The state is home to numerous industrial parks and manufacturing facilities, particularly in the automotive, aerospace, and electronics sectors. Its proximity to major Mexican cities like León, Silao, and Salamanca creates a dense industrial cluster that generates significant freight volume. Guanajuato benefits from excellent ground transportation infrastructure, including access to Federal Highway 45, which connects directly to the US border, and its own international airport supporting air freight operations.
Destination
Atlanta
Atlanta, Georgia stands as a premier logistics hub in the southeastern United States, offering unparalleled connectivity and distribution capabilities. The city's Hartsfield-Jackson Atlanta International Airport, one of the world's busiest cargo airports, combined with extensive rail networks and major interstate highways (I-20, I-75, I-85) create a multimodal transportation powerhouse. Atlanta's strategic location provides access to over 80% of the US population within a two-hour flight radius. The metropolitan area hosts numerous distribution centers, warehousing facilities, and serves as a gateway for goods distribution throughout the eastern United States, making it an ideal destination for freight from Mexico's manufacturing centers.
